There are 8 ways to get from Saint Augustine to Santa Rosa Beach by taxi, bus, car, or plane
Select an option below to see step-by-step directions and to compare ticket prices and travel times in Rome2Rio's travel planner.
Taxi, bus
best- Take the taxi from Saint Augustine to Green Cove Springs Jr Hightaxi
- Take the bus from Green Cove Springs Jr High to Keystone Heights Senior Centerbus 904
- Take the taxi from Keystone Heights Senior Center to Circle K - Gainesville, FLtaxi
- Take the bus from Circle K - Gainesville, FL to Whataburger - Defuniak Springsbus
- Take the taxi from Whataburger - Defuniak Springs to Santa Rosa Beachtaxi
7h 55m$308–475Drive 332.1 mi
cheapest- Drive from Saint Augustine to Santa Rosa Beachcar 332.1 mi
5h 55m$61–88Taxi to Daytona Beach International Airport, fly to Northwest Florida Beaches International Airport, taxi
- Take the taxi from Saint Augustine to Daytona-Beach-Airport-DABtaxi
- Fly from Daytona Beach International Airport (DAB) to Northwest Florida Beaches International Airport (ECP)plane DAB - ECP
- Take the taxi from Northwest Florida Beaches International Airport (ECP) to Santa Rosa Beachtaxi
5h 57m$307–764Bus, taxi
- Take the bus from St. Johns Adminsistration to JRTC Bay Ubus
- Take the bus from Jacksonville to Gainesvillebus
- Take the bus from Circle K - Gainesville, FL to Whataburger - Defuniak Springsbus
- Take the taxi from Whataburger - Defuniak Springs to Santa Rosa Beachtaxi
9h 49m$178–319Bus, taxi via Tallahassee
- Take the bus from St. Johns Adminsistration to JRTC Bay Ubus
- Take the bus from Jacksonville to Tallahasseebus
- Take the bus from Flying J Travel Cntr - Tallahassee, FL to Whataburger - Defuniak Springsbus
- Take the taxi from Whataburger - Defuniak Springs to Santa Rosa Beachtaxi
10h 21m$170–335Taxi to Daytona Beach International Airport, fly to Destin–Fort Walton Beach Airport, taxi
- Take the taxi from Saint Augustine to Daytona-Beach-Airport-DABtaxi
- Fly from Daytona Beach International Airport (DAB) to Destin–Fort Walton Beach Airport (VPS)plane DAB - VPS
- Take the taxi from Destin–Fort Walton Beach Airport (VPS) to Santa Rosa Beachtaxi
6h 22m$282–734Bus to Jacksonville, fly to Northwest Florida Beaches International Airport, taxi
- Take the bus from St. Johns Adminsistration to Pearl St. & Bay St.bus
- Fly from Jacksonville (JAX) to Northwest Florida Beaches International Airport (ECP)plane JAX - ECP
- Take the taxi from Northwest Florida Beaches International Airport (ECP) to Santa Rosa Beachtaxi
8h 7m$188–600Bus to Jacksonville, fly to Destin–Fort Walton Beach Airport, taxi
- Take the bus from St. Johns Adminsistration to Pearl St. & Bay St.bus
- Fly from Jacksonville (JAX) to Destin–Fort Walton Beach Airport (VPS)plane JAX - VPS
- Take the taxi from Destin–Fort Walton Beach Airport (VPS) to Santa Rosa Beachtaxi
8h 22m$163–570
Daytona Beach International Airport (DAB) to Northwest Florida Beaches International Airport (ECP) flights
Questions & Answers
The cheapest way to get from Saint Augustine to Santa Rosa Beach is to drive which costs $60 - $90 and takes 5h 55m.
The fastest way to get from Saint Augustine to Santa Rosa Beach is to drive which takes 5h 55m and costs $60 - $90.
The distance between Saint Augustine and Santa Rosa Beach is 391 miles. The road distance is 334 miles.
The best way to get from Saint Augustine to Santa Rosa Beach without a car is to taxi and bus which takes 7h 55m and costs $300 - $480.
It takes approximately 7h 55m to get from Saint Augustine to Santa Rosa Beach, including transfers.
Santa Rosa Beach is 1h behind Saint Augustine. It is currently 1:03 PM in Saint Augustine and 12:03 PM in Santa Rosa Beach.
Yes, the driving distance between Saint Augustine to Santa Rosa Beach is 334 miles. It takes approximately 5h 55m to drive from Saint Augustine to Santa Rosa Beach.
There are 2795+ hotels available in Santa Rosa Beach.
What companies run services between Saint Augustine, FL, USA and Santa Rosa Beach, FL, USA?
There is no direct connection from Saint Augustine to Santa Rosa Beach. However, you can take the taxi to Green Cove Springs Jr High, take the bus to Keystone Heights Senior Center, take the taxi to Circle K - Gainesville, FL, take the bus to Whataburger - Defuniak Springs, then take the taxi to Santa Rosa Beach. Alternatively, you can drive from Saint Augustine to Santa Rosa Beach in around 5h 55m.
- Website
- delta.com
Flights from Daytona Beach International Airport to Northwest Florida Beaches International Airport via Atlanta
- Ave. Duration
- 4h 59m
- When
- Every day
- Estimated price
- $90–500
Flights from Daytona Beach International Airport to Destin–Fort Walton Beach Airport via Atlanta
- Ave. Duration
- 5h 16m
- When
- Every day
- Estimated price
- $90–500
Flights from Jacksonville to Northwest Florida Beaches International Airport via Atlanta
- Ave. Duration
- 4h 16m
- When
- Every day
- Estimated price
- $80–460
Flights from Jacksonville to Destin–Fort Walton Beach Airport via Atlanta
- Ave. Duration
- 4h 20m
- When
- Every day
- Estimated price
- $80–460
- Website
- aa.com
Flights from Daytona Beach International Airport to Northwest Florida Beaches International Airport via Charlotte
- Ave. Duration
- 5h 47m
- When
- Every day
- Estimated price
- $110–600
Flights from Daytona Beach International Airport to Destin–Fort Walton Beach Airport via Charlotte
- Ave. Duration
- 5h 21m
- When
- Every day
- Estimated price
- $110–600
Flights from Jacksonville to Northwest Florida Beaches International Airport via Charlotte
- Ave. Duration
- 6h 36m
- When
- Every day
- Estimated price
- $100–550
Flights from Jacksonville to Destin–Fort Walton Beach Airport via Miami
- Ave. Duration
- 4h 27m
- When
- Monday, Tuesday, Wednesday, Thursday, Friday, and Sunday
- Estimated price
- $100–550
Flights from Jacksonville to Destin–Fort Walton Beach Airport via Charlotte
- Ave. Duration
- 5h 28m
- When
- Every day
- Estimated price
- $100–550
- Website
- southwest.com
Flights from Jacksonville to Northwest Florida Beaches International Airport via Nashville
- Ave. Duration
- 5h 32m
- When
- Every day
- Estimated price
- $100–550
Flights from Jacksonville to Northwest Florida Beaches International Airport via Baltimore
- Ave. Duration
- 6h 30m
- When
- Saturday
- Estimated price
- $150–700
Flights from Jacksonville to Northwest Florida Beaches International Airport via St. Louis
- Ave. Duration
- 6h 40m
- When
- Thursday and Friday
- Estimated price
- $140–700
Flights from Jacksonville to Northwest Florida Beaches International Airport via Houston Hobby Apt
- Ave. Duration
- 7h
- When
- Thursday, Friday, and Sunday
- Estimated price
- $140–700
Flights from Jacksonville to Destin–Fort Walton Beach Airport via Nashville
- Ave. Duration
- 5h 45m
- When
- Thursday to Sunday
- Estimated price
- $100–550
- Phone
- +1 904-630-3100
- Website
- jtafla.com
Bus from Green Cove Springs Jr High to Keystone Heights Senior Center
- Ave. Duration
- 46 min
- Frequency
- Twice daily
- Estimated price
- $1–3
- Website
- https://www.jtafla.com
Bus from St. Johns Adminsistration to JRTC Bay U
- Ave. Duration
- 1h 15m
- Frequency
- Twice daily
- Estimated price
- $1–3
- Website
- https://www.jtafla.com
Bus from St. Johns Adminsistration to Pearl St. & Bay St.
- Ave. Duration
- 1h 12m
- Frequency
- Once daily
- Estimated price
- $1–3
- Website
- https://www.jtafla.com
- Phone
- +1 888 358 6762
- info@tornadobus.com
- Website
- tornadobus.com
Bus from Circle K - Gainesville, FL to Whataburger - Defuniak Springs
- Ave. Duration
- 4h 15m
- Frequency
- Once daily
- Estimated price
- $60–170
- Schedules at
- tornadobus.com
- Adults 11-59
- $60–170
Bus from Flying J Travel Cntr - Tallahassee, FL to Whataburger - Defuniak Springs
- Ave. Duration
- 2h 3m
- Frequency
- Once daily
- Estimated price
- $40–140
- Schedules at
- tornadobus.com
- Adults 11-59
- $40–140
- Phone
- +1 (855) 626-8585
- Website
- flixbus.com
Bus from Jacksonville to Gainesville
- Ave. Duration
- 1h 30m
- Frequency
- 6 times a week
- Estimated price
- $17–24
- Schedules at
- flixbus.com
Rome2Rio's guide to Greyhound USA
Contact Details
- Phone
- +1 214-849-8100
- ifsr@greyhound.com
- Website
- greyhound.com
Bus from Jacksonville to Tallahassee
- Ave. Duration
- 3h 10m
- Frequency
- Twice daily
- Estimated price
- $29–70
- Website
- https://www.greyhound.com/
- Ave. Duration
- 45 min
- Estimated price
- $70–150
Red Cabs of Panama City
- Phone
- +1 850-733-2227
- Website
- myfloridacabs.com
H2O Shuttle Taxi and Limo
- Phone
- +1 850-708-2870
Emerald Taxi
- Phone
- +1 850-792-2546
- Website
- emeraldtaxiandshuttle.com
Quickie Taxi
- Phone
- +1 850-716-6545
- Website
- quickietaxi.com
Red Cabs of Panama City
- Phone
- +1 850-733-2227
- Website
- myfloridacabs.com
H2O Shuttle Taxi and Limo
- Phone
- +1 850-708-2870
Emerald Taxi
- Phone
- +1 850-792-2546
- Website
- emeraldtaxiandshuttle.com
Quickie Taxi
- Phone
- +1 850-716-6545
- Website
- quickietaxi.com
Want to know more about travelling around United States
Rome2Rio's Travel Guide series provide vital information for the global traveller. Filled with useful and timely travel information, the guides answer all the hard questions - such as 'How do I buy a ticket?', 'Should I book online before I travel? ', 'How much should I expect to pay?', 'Do the trains and buses have Wifi?' - to help you get the most out of your next trip.
Related travel guides
Travelling to the US: What do I need to know?
Read the travel guide
Need to know: Greyhound
Read the travel guide








